The latest album from The Heads showcases the band’s unique blend of brutalist psychedelic rock, demonstrating the depth of their musical evolution over the years. Known for their distinctive sound and experimental approach, the band continues to push boundaries and defy expectations with their latest release.

With a career spanning several decades, The Heads have honed their craft and refined their signature style. This new album is a testament to their growth as musicians, featuring intricate compositions and mind-bending sonic textures that captivate listeners from start to finish.

Drawing on influences from across the musical spectrum, The Heads weave together elements of psychedelic rock, krautrock, and avant-garde music to create a sound that is uniquely their own. Their ability to seamlessly blend disparate genres and styles sets them apart from their peers and establishes them as true innovators in the world of psychedelic music.

From the opening track to the closing notes, the album takes listeners on a mesmerizing journey through a sonic landscape that is both familiar and otherworldly. Each song unfolds like a fever dream, with layers of distorted guitars, swirling synths, and thunderous drums building to a crescendo of sound that is at once exhilarating and overwhelming.

One of the most striking aspects of the album is the band’s fearless approach to experimentation. They are unafraid to push the boundaries of conventional song structures and explore new sonic territories, resulting in a collection of songs that are as unpredictable as they are captivating.

The Heads have always been known for their electrifying live performances, and this album captures the raw energy and intensity of their shows in a way that few studio recordings can. The songs pulse with a primal urgency that is impossible to ignore, drawing listeners in and holding them captive until the very last note fades away.

With this latest release, The Heads have once again proven why they are considered one of the foremost innovators in the world of psychedelic rock. Their ability to evolve and adapt while staying true to their core sound is a testament to their talent and dedication to pushing the boundaries of what is possible in music.

In conclusion, The Heads’ latest album is a tour de force of psychedelic rock that showcases the band’s unrivaled creativity and musicianship. Fans of experimental music and adventurous listeners alike will find much to love in this mesmerizing collection of songs, which cements The Heads’ legacy as true pioneers of the genre.
